**Purpose of the role**

Provide admin support and assist in working towards the objectives of the school. This may involve providing support to a project or task, which may include the creation of basic management information systems, and financial monitoring of transactions.

**Responsibilities**
- Assist in the day to day organisation and provision of the admin services
- Maintain records, organise meetings, room and travel bookings, maintaining office systems
- Provide analysis and evaluation of data and information in the most appropriate format and produce reports accordingly
- Ensure office equipment, stationary and other office consumables are ordered in accordance with the Schools purchasing procedures
- Respond to more complicated non-routine queries from parents/ carers, members of the public and school staff whilst drawing on an understanding of school protocols, internal polices and external regulations
- Undertake accurate data-inputting, word processing and other IT based tasks as well as the management of computerised and manual records
- Assist senior staff in planning, development and monitoring of the school admin systems
- Undertake reception duties
- Take special measures to safeguard the confidentiality of the schools information and data in relation to password protection.
- Be responsible for locking away confidential data
- Operate, and on occasion, demonstrate to other staff specific IT packages
- Completion and submission of monitoring forms, returns including those that are statutory and to external bodies
- Mentor and allocate work to more junior staff who are school office team members
- Within an agreed system of supervision, manage small projects in school
- Process all relevant orders and invoices within the school in accordance with financial procedures
- Undertake monthly payroll reports and act as key contact
- Provide financial information in an appropriate manner to allow senior staff to undertake financial planning and decision making
- When required, provide support to senior staff to assist with developing school procedures and practice to improve service delivery.
